Detalji o proizvodu
The Turck Banner EZ-BEAM Q40 series of sensors feature EZ-BEAM technology that has specially designed optics and electronics for reliable sensing without the need of adjustments.
The Q40 series sensors are completely epoxy-encapsulated for superior durability, Even in harsh sensing environments and use an innovative dual-indicator system to take the guesswork out of monitoring sensor performance.
